Speak Openly of the Situation

The initial crisis recovery measure lies in the admission of the problem. The viewers are likely to enjoy openness rather than silence. As brands are open about what happened and what they are doing to rectify the issue, they will start regaining trust.

Frequent mentions, considerate replies to remarks, and news pieces regarding the positive changes can assist the audiences in understanding that the brand is acting responsibly. This openness will in most cases minimize the negative responses and motivate individuals to give the brand a second opportunity.

Open communication is also the evidence that the company cares about its audience.

Restore Communication with the Community

Engaging communities is very important in the restoration of reputation. The brands must be responsive to the comments, answer queries and be active in discussions with the followers.

The audience will become more forgiving of the past mistakes when they feel that their voices are being heard and taken seriously. The social media platforms will offer the optimal platform to restore these relationships.

The discussion and feedbacks should be encouraged to slowly rebuild the brand image and enhance the relationship between the brand and the community.

Monitor Public Sentiment

Monitoring reaction of the audience is necessary in crisis recovery. The brands are advised to track comments, trends and public sentiments to see how perceptions are evolving with time.

This feedback assists in determining the strategies that are working and what more communication is necessary.

Brands can manage to maneuver the recovery stage by modifying their strategy in accordance with the reactions of the audience.
